Finally, the Becos FX TS8-JZ has arrived.
here's a real pic:
WhatsApp Image 2026-05-19 at 17.54.34.jpeg

JZ is for Jordan Ziff, who is apparently a metal guitarist.
Just from the feature set, one could assume this is a bass pedal.

What do I have here? It's a mini Tube Screamer variant with extra knobs and switches.
Apart from the TS typical Drive/Level/Tone trio, there is a switch that lets you set clipping options.
Position 1 is regular silicon clipping.
Position 2 is asymmetrical silicon clipping.
Position 3 is red LED clipping.

The other switch is labeled 'Deep' and it feeds more low end to the clippers.
Then there are the two little red knobs. One does dry/wet mix.
The other is a tilt EQ, centered at 750Hz, and it only affects the dry signal.

It takes 9-18V, and you can not run it with an internal 9V battery, there's no room.
 
Okay. Here's what I can say for a first impression.

There is some depth to the pedal, but it is not too complicated, but some of it is trial and error.
I'll have to measure things, but my guess is that the tone knob is some sort of standard passive treble control, turn it all the way up for 'neutral', turn it down to dampen the top.
The gain knob works like a TS. It passes signal at zero, and output volume does increase a little as you turn it up, just like the original.
The Deep switch is some sort of pre gain bass boost, or maybe it lowers the filter threshold at the clipping stage (if such a thing exists), but it certainly makes it sound bigger and weightier.

The true challenge is to balance the wet/dry mix, the dry EQ and the gain. There are no crazy interactions between the knobs and everything feels pretty linear, but it's three knobs, two of which are somewhat hard to fine tune with bassist fingers.
Basically, I'm currently working my way forward by setting one and then toying around with the two others to find a balance.
I am clearly leaning towards emphasis on the low end for the tilt EQ, but I'm running it closer to noon than I would have imagined.
 
Played completely wet, it sounds very much like a tube screamer, with the mids push and a somewhat thinned out low end, so it is more or less mandatory to make use of the blend function and pump in some undistorted lows.
